The panel you guys are showing has multipurposes that may not be obvious…

The times panel will change depending on which button you push.

When you push the Show File Creation Times Times button, it will show you creation times you have set.

When you push the Show File Upload Times button, it will show you the upload times you have set.

There is also an Upload this file now… which should upload the file right then when you push it.

i see you are using the special file conversion, in the web files/web page setup, custom web page setup
but you dont have the main switch on there…turn that on
the next problem is, you have the customise internet and file creation override switch on (see under control panel), but you do not have any times set to create or upload any files there
so turn that switch off
